I believe that much of our suffering as humans comes from disconnection. When we experience hardship and trauma, we disconnect from our very essence out of pure survival. Our new normal becomes surviving. This lack of meaning and purpose can manifest in a variety of ways. My therapy is designed to help reconnect you with your “why” so that you shift from survival into meaning and live a purpose-driven life. Together we will identify your core values, unravel your limiting beliefs, and restore your nervous system to a state of harmony so that you can function in a way that brings you ease and joy.

Lōkahi is a Hawaiian concept representing unity and connection. I believe wellbeing arises from being in alignment. When our mind, body, and soul are in balance, we can develop a deep sense of peace within ourselves that allows us to live in harmony with each other and the world. Although this state of being cannot prevent hardship or struggle, it brings an unwavering resilience and knowing that there is always hope.
